Abstract
The invention relates to a spinal traction therapeutic device, which effectively solves the problem that the existing spinal traction therapeutic device only has a single traction function and does not massage the traction part of a patient; the technical scheme comprises the following steps: be equipped with massage draw gear in the back backup pad, be equipped with shank massage device in the shank backup pad, this massage draw gear still can massage for patient's back when pulling for the patient, can prevent effectively that the patient from pulling the position and producing discomfort such as pain because be in traction state for a long time, back backup pad and shank backup pad below are connected with first adjusting device, this first adjusting device can adjust back backup pad and shank backup pad angle, make both mutually support and present different traction angle for the patient, it is better to make traction effect, the massage device who sets up in the shank backup pad can massage for patient's shank and prevent to be in the tensile state for a long time and produce the ache because of the shank.
